RMIT FactLab is a research center focused on fighting misinformation on the internet and increasing understanding of where it comes from and how it spreads. Additionally, the hub carries out original studies on the digital news landscape.

    The false claims followed a study published in the journal Nature Cities in January 2024 whose findings and authors have been misrepresented. The study analysed the carbon footprints of 73 urban agriculture (UA) sites in five countries. It then calculated the climate change impacts per serving of produce and compared the results to those for conventional agriculture products.

    By Lulu Graham and Kathryn WhitfieldMisinformation about who is funding the Voice referendum campaigns has resurfaced, with social media users claiming the Albanese government is throwing taxpayers’ money at the Yes campaign. The claims have been repeatedly posted on Facebook and Instagram accounts, even though they have been previously shown to be false by fact checkers.
